Pediatric Specialists of Virginia’s Ambulatory Surgery Received AAAHC Reaccreditation

Feb 19, 2018

Pediatric Specialists of Virginia (PSV) is excited to announce that our pediatric Ambulatory Surgery Center has officially received reaccreditation from the Accreditation Association for Ambulatory Health Care (AAAHC) in late February, 2018 for another three years!

The AAAHC is the leader in ambulatory health care accreditation as they have set the bar for developing standards to advance and promote patient safety, quality and value for ambulatory health care through peer-based accreditation processes, education, and research.

Therefore, an organization that receives AAAHC accreditation means its healthcare system/ambulatory surgery center meets or exceeds nationally-recognized standards for quality of care and patient safety.
